The Massachusetts Conservation Planning and Implementation Support Partnership Fiscal Year 2019 Announcement for Funding is a discretionary federal funding opportunity released by the USDA Natural Resources Conservation Service (NRCS) through its Massachusetts State Office. The program is designed to build partnerships with organizations that can deliver direct, on-the-ground technical assistance to help plan and carry out conservation practices across Massachusetts. The emphasis is practical implementation and field-based support that advances NRCS conservation objectives in the state, rather than academic or experimental work. Research proposals are explicitly not eligible under this announcement.

Funding is offered through cooperative agreements under CFDA 10.902 (Natural Resources-related assistance). For FY 2019, NRCS Massachusetts anticipated up to $800,000 total available for awards, depending on final funding availability at the time awards are made. NRCS expected to make multiple awards (listed as about five), with individual projects typically running between one and three years. The notice also allows multi-year applications, as long as the applicant meets eligibility requirements and follows the program rules.

Eligible applicants are broadly defined and include entities actively delivering conservation programs and services in Massachusetts. Examples specifically mentioned include nonprofit organizations, governmental and non-governmental organizations, institutions of higher education, and Federally recognized Indian Tribal Organizations. While eligibility is described as relatively open, proposals still need to align with the announcement priorities and comply with the detailed instructions in the full notice to remain under consideration.

The announcement makes it clear that applications will be competitively reviewed and screened first for completeness and compliance. Proposals that are missing required elements or do not follow the solicitation requirements can be eliminated before scoring, and applicants will be notified if their submission is removed from consideration for those reasons. It also notes that the Massachusetts State Conservationist retains the discretion to fund all, some, or none of the applications received, even if they are otherwise eligible, which is a standard federal safeguard tied to priorities, quality, and funding constraints.

The central purpose of the partnership is to increase capacity for conservation planning and implementation, meaning partners are expected to provide hands-on technical services that support landowners and conservation outcomes throughout the state. The specific conservation priorities and objectives are referenced as being laid out in Section A of the announcement, and proposal evaluation criteria and performance metrics are referenced as being in Section E. In other words, applicants are expected to build their work plans around the stated Massachusetts NRCS priorities and to describe measurable outputs and outcomes that match the evaluation framework NRCS will use to rank proposals.

Key administrative details included in the opportunity listing are the funding opportunity number (USDA-NRCS-MA-CTA-19-GEN0010275), the posting date (June 1, 2019), and the original application deadline (July 16, 2019).
